囲む · godan verb (-mu)
| Form | Positive | Negative |
|---|---|---|
| Dictionary | 囲む | 囲まない |
| Polite | 囲みます | 囲みません |
| Past polite | 囲みました | 囲みませんでした |
| Past | 囲んだ | 囲まなかった |
| Te-form | 囲んで | 囲まないで |
| Desire | 囲みたい | 囲みたくない |
| Potential | 囲める | 囲めない |
| Passive | 囲まれる | 囲まれない |
| Causative | 囲ませる | 囲ませない |
| Causative passive | 囲ませられるalso 囲まされる | 囲ませられないalso 囲まされない |
| Volitional | 囲もう | |
| Polite volitional | 囲みましょう | |
| Imperative | 囲め | 囲むな |
| Conditional | 囲めば | 囲まなければ |
| Tara conditional | 囲んだら | 囲まなかったら |
godan verb (-mu), transitive verb
General physical and abstract use: people or things forming a circle around something, or a space being enclosed.
The children sat around the teacher.
庭を塀で囲む。
I enclose the garden with a fence.
godan verb (-mu), transitive verb
besiege; lay siege to
Military or figurative use: surrounding a place to attack or pressure it.
敵軍が城を囲んだ。
The enemy army laid siege to the castle.
godan verb (-mu), transitive verb
Used for board games where players sit around the board, especially go and shogi.
週末はよく友人と碁を囲む。
I often play go with friends on weekends.
